Ribfest Chicago takes place every summer in the Northcenter neighborhood! Celebrating 26 years of BBQ, Ribfest Chicago continues to be Chicago’s most anticipated food festival. Come enjoy the sweet smells of BBQ filling the streets of Lincoln, Damen and Irving Park Rd. Lincoln Ave. between Irving Park Rd. and Hutchinson We request a $10 suggested donation at the gate. Proceeds from the gate donations are invested right back into the Northcenter community and help support local schools and nonprofit organizations, economic development and greening efforts. To date, the fest has provided nearly $400,000 in direct funding to these worthy causes. Street festivals are non profit fundraisers, not city funded events. Learn More

The Lincoln Park Greek Fest brings all the aromas, sounds, tastes and traditions of Greece to your doorstep. St. George Greek Orthodox Church in the Lincoln Park area of Chicago’s north side and was established in 1923 by Greek immigrants. St. George remains an important center for worship and fellowship for its parishioners and friends from throughout the Chicagoland area. Through the gifts of the holy spirit in faith and determination these new Americans were able to purchase the Lutheran Church at 2701 N. Sheffield Avenue and adapt it for Orthodox worship in time for services to be held in April 1923. Being Greek means relishing the world around you and enjoying life to its fullest. The 57th Street Art Fair is a free, juried outdoor art fair in Chicago's Hyde Park neighborhood, running along 57th Street between Woodlawn and Kenwood Avenues and on Kimbark Avenue. Held on the first full weekend of June each year, the 2026 fair marks its 80th annual edition and draws more than 20,000 visitors, with live blues music at the Buddy Guy's Legends stage. Artists exhibit their work in booths throughout the weekend and apply through Zapplication with a non-refundable jury fee.
